Marrakech Weather Throughout the Year

Marrakech enjoys a semi-arid climate with sunshine almost all year round. Summers can be extremely hot, while winters remain mild and pleasant compared to many other destinations.

During summer months, temperatures often exceed 38°C (100°F), while winter daytime temperatures usually range between 18°C and 22°C (64°F to 72°F).

Thanks to its generally warm climate, Marrakech can be visited year-round. However, some seasons offer more comfortable conditions for exploring the city and its surrounding landscapes.

Spring and Autumn: The Best Seasons to Visit Marrakech

Spring (March to June) and autumn (September to November) are widely considered the best times to visit Marrakech.

During these months, temperatures are pleasant and typically range between 23°C and 30°C (73°F to 86°F). This comfortable weather allows visitors to explore the city without experiencing the intense heat of summer.

These seasons are perfect for wandering through the vibrant streets of the medina, exploring traditional souks and visiting the city's historical landmarks.

Spring and autumn are also ideal for discovering Marrakech’s beautiful gardens such as the famous Majorelle Garden, the Menara Gardens, and the peaceful courtyards hidden within traditional riads.

In addition, these months provide excellent conditions for excursions outside the city. Popular experiences include exploring the Agafay Desert, hiking in the Atlas Mountains or discovering traditional Berber villages.

Thanks to the pleasant temperatures and sunny skies, spring and autumn offer the perfect balance for travelers looking to fully experience Marrakech.

Visiting Marrakech in Summer

Summer in Marrakech, between June and August, is the hottest time of the year. Temperatures can sometimes exceed 40°C (104°F), making outdoor activities more challenging during the middle of the day.

However, many travelers still visit during summer and enjoy the city's luxurious riads and hotels, many of which feature refreshing pools and air-conditioned spaces.

During this season, activities are often planned early in the morning or later in the evening when temperatures are cooler. Summer can also be a great time to organize excursions into the Atlas Mountains or spend a night in the desert.

Visiting Marrakech in Winter

Winter, from December to February, remains relatively mild in Marrakech.

Daytime temperatures usually range between 18°C and 22°C (64°F to 72°F), although evenings can be cooler.

This season is ideal for travelers who want to avoid peak tourist crowds while still enjoying comfortable weather for sightseeing. The winter light is also particularly beautiful, making it a great time for photography.

Winter is also a good opportunity to combine a stay in Marrakech with trips to the nearby Atlas Mountains, where the peaks are sometimes covered with snow.

Can You Visit Marrakech During Ramadan?

Did you know? It is absolutely possible to visit Marrakech during Ramadan.

Although this holy month slightly changes the daily rhythm of the city, tourists remain very welcome. Some restaurants may be closed during the day, but the city comes alive after sunset.

In the evening, locals gather to break their fast and the atmosphere becomes lively and festive. For travelers interested in culture, visiting during Ramadan can be a unique and enriching experience.

Summary: When Should You Visit Marrakech?

The best time to visit Marrakech is generally during spring and autumn, when temperatures are comfortable and ideal for sightseeing and outdoor activities.

However, every season offers a different experience. Whether you want to explore the lively souks, discover Morocco's breathtaking landscapes, or immerse yourself in the city's rich culture, Marrakech remains a fascinating destination throughout the year.
